Contract Data Engineer & Analyst – GBP400/pd

Company: Cyber Security training courses
Apply for the Contract Data Engineer & Analyst – GBP400/pd
Location: Newcastle upon Tyne
Job Description:

Contract Data Engineer & Analyst – £400/pd

Please note – this role will require you to be based in the North East and able to attend the Newcastle office 2-3 days per week. This organisation is not able to offer sponsorship.

We are seeking an experienced Data Engineer / Data Analyst contractor to provide hybrid support across data engineering and analysis during a team refresh. This engagement is initially for 3 months, with a strong focus on maintaining business-as-usual reporting and delivering a key migration from Excel to SQL / Power BI.

This role requires a self-sufficient, trusted contractor who can quickly understand an existing data estate, work confidently with limited documentation, and make sound recommendations when improving or stabilising solutions.

Key responsibilities

  • Maintain and support existing data pipelines to ensure BAU continuity
  • Convert a critical Excel-based report/dashboard into a robust SQL and Power BI solution
  • Deliver ad-hoc, priority reporting requests as needed
  • Work independently to analyse data structures and logic where documentation is limited
  • Provide a clear handover to the incoming Data & Insights Manager at the end of the contract

Required experience

  • Proven experience across data engineering and analytical reporting in live environments
  • Strong capability working autonomously with minimal oversight or documentation
  • Confidence in making recommendations and proposing practical improvements
  • Experience supporting BAU reporting alongside project work
  • Strong communication skills, particularly around handover and knowledge transfer

Technology in use

  • Azure SQL Databases
  • Azure Ubuntu Virtual Machines
  • Apache Airflow
  • Power BI
  • Python
  • REST & SOAP APIs

#J-18808-Ljbffr…

Posted: April 20th, 2026